> Hello, everyone.
> In order to facilitate our communications presence on social media, I have
> asked Travis Moses to chair a conference call on FaceBook and Twitter for
> Dummies. This will be on Wednesday, March 29, 2017, at 6:00 P.M. Hopefully
> this won't take longer than an hour. Interested attendees should have a
> basic knowledge of computer and internet skills. I think it would be
> effective if someone from each chapter was represented. We should have a
> social media point person for the affiliate. Then we can funnel news to that
> person about what our chapters are doing, when the meetings are, what our
> fundraisers are, etc. I put that information on NFB Newsline, but not
> everybody accesses that, and our social media presence would be more for the
> benefit of those who don't know about us yet, or those who do but want to
> stay informed and up to date on what we are doing and planning to do in
> Montana. There is a current campaign going on on social media where
> individuals can post "why I am a Federationist." Sharing memorable personal
> stories is one way to recruit new members.

> Live the life you want
> The National Federation of the Blind knows that blindness is not the
> characteristic that defines you or your future. Every day we raise the
> expectations of blind people, because low expectations create obstacles
> between blind people and our dreams. You can live the life you want;
> blindness is not what holds you back.
